The Books Along the Teche Festival partners with the Iberia Parish library, Sir Speedy print shop and The Daily Iberian to give students a chance to test their literary skills and possibly win a prize. 

Students grades fourth through sixth can enter the essay contest, which sees contestants writing a 50-200 word story based on adventures in south Louisiana or the Children’s library alligator mascot Choo Choo. Judges will grade the works on originality, creativity/style, and grammar. 

To enter, contestants should drop off submissions written on lined paper attached to a completed application form. Students can drop off their submission to the Children’s Room of the Main Branch of the Iberia Parish Library anytime before Monday, March 20. 

First place will receive $50, with second receiving $2, third receiving $20 and Honorable mentions receiving $15. Each place will earn a certificate alongside their prize award.

Judges will announce winning entries Saturday, April 1 at noon at George Rodrigue Memorial Park.
